The RubbleCrusher RC150T is a tracked jaw crusher and the go-to machine for small to medium-sized crushing projects. This plant offers on-site recycling of construction and demolition materials, capable of crushing at up to 50 tph. It's an ideal solution for contractors, landscapers, pavers and hardscapers...

Features
Anti clogging mechanism (auto reverse of jaw based on blocked jaw cavity)
Reversible jaw - good for asphalt
Quick set-up time
Compact and mobile with large jaw box
Remote control for tracks and crusher operation
US Compliant Caterpillar tier 4 diesel engine
Rubber tracked undercarriage
Hydraulic product conveyor
Fully automatic hydraulic adjust crusher gap setting (no manual spring tensioning)

RubbleCrusher by McLanahan makes robust, compact crushers and screeners for on-site recycling of construction and demolition waste. Engineered for simplicity and sturdiness, these user-friendly machines facilitate efficient operations and easy transportation across diverse sites, catering to smaller to medium-sized recycling projects as well as larger-scale applications.
